How can I make the upper panel non transparent while using the dock?

I am using the the Zorin layout with the panel on top and the dock at the bottom. The only thing I want to change is that the upper panel isn't transparent, but this configuration option is greyed out while using this layout. I can only adjust it while using a different layout.

How can I make the upper panel non transparent while using the dock? I tried using gnome extensions like dash to dock and dash to panel simultaneously, but that does not work, because as soon as I toggle on dash to panel the dock is gone.

In the Extension Settings should be an Option to turn on the Gnome Shell Top Panel. You find this Option in the Zorin Taskbar Settings, too. It is in the Action Tab when You scroll down. There is an Option to keep the original Gnome Shell Top Bar where You have to activate the Toggle to get it:

In Dash to Panel, it should be similar to that.

But even then the Transparency leads to the Standard or used Theme Value. To adress that, You can use Gnome Extensions. The first Option offers beneath adjustable Transparency a lot of more Customization Options:
